Fun but be prepared to repair it
I have a 2011 Mazdaspeed3. 1 year after owning it I wanted some feedback directly from the Mazda dealership. They provided ABSOLUTELY NOTHING! I asked if they could tell me some of the service intervals of this car especially when it comes to cleaning out the carbon. I was told to look in the owners manual. I looked and could not find ANYTHING! I took my car to a mechanic I’ve used for years and asked them to do a carbon cleaning. The put some cleaner in the fuel tank and said it would be fine. 2 intake valves broke 1 year later costing me $2500 to repair. It did not work because the car is Direct Injection. 6 months later my shocks blow out. $1000 repair. It’s fun if you like repairs and turbocharged engines.
